Remote Electronic Unit REU in Germany Trends and Forecast
The future of the remote electronic unit REU market in Germany looks promising with opportunities in the original equipment manufacturer (OEM), aftermarket markets. The global remote electronic unit REU market is expected to reach an estimated $8.1 billion by 2031 with a CAGR of 11.9% from 2025 to 2031. The remote electronic unit REU market in Germany is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the advancements in fly-by-wire & electric actuation systems technology, the development of miniaturized remote electronic units in the aerospace industry, and a rise in the number of satellite constellations.
• Lucintel forecasts that, within the platform category, spacecraft is expected to witness the highest growth over the forecast period.
• Within the end use category, OEM will remain the largest segment.

Remote Electronic Unit REU Market in Germany Driver and Challenges
The REU market in Germany is diverse due to several different technological, economic, and regulatory factors. GermanyÄX%$%Xs industrial growth, commitment to renewable energy, and strong digital transformation are drivers for the expansion of the market, but challenges to its widespread adoption come through cybersecurity risks, regulatory requirements, and issues related to the potential need for system integration.
The factors responsible for driving the remote electronic unit REU Market in Germany include:
• Technological Advancements in Communication: New wireless communication technologies, such as 5G and LPWAN, are a major driver for the REU market in Germany. These technologies ensure that REUs can transmit data over long distances, making them highly effective for remote monitoring and control in diverse industries.
• Sustainability and Renewable Energy Goals: The strong drive by Germany toward renewable energy creates the need for REUs to enhance the efficiency of solar, wind, and biomass systems. The units ensure proper management of energy production and consumption, in support of Germany’s sustainability goal.
• Digitalization and Industry 4.0: The demand for REUs is on the rise in Germany as it continues to adopt Industry 4.0 and digital manufacturing. These units help monitor real-time data, predictive maintenance, and automated decision-making, which are critical for optimizing production and minimizing downtime in the industrial sector.
• Cost-Effectiveness of Remote Monitoring: REUs, through their ability to monitor systems and equipment, are introducing the benefit of no need for people on-site. This helps industries save on operational costs and increase efficiency in sectors like manufacturing, energy, and telecommunications.
• German Government Support Toward Smart Infrastructure: The German government is investing in smart cities and infrastructure, boosting the growth of REUs in urban development. REUs can monitor and regulate urban systems, including transportation, waste management, and energy usage, leading to more efficient and sustainable cities.
Challenges in the remote electronic unit REU Market in Germany are:
• Cybersecurity Risks: With more industries embracing REUs, the risk of cyberattacks and data breaches increases. The security of remote monitoring systems and protection of sensitive data pose significant challenges to businesses in Germany, especially in sectors such as energy, telecommunications, and healthcare.
• Regulatory Compliance: The regulations in Germany regarding data privacy and environmental standards are very complex. Companies have to navigate these to ensure that their REU systems comply with national and international standards, which add to the cost and complexity of deployment.
• Integration with Legacy Systems: Most German industries still rely on legacy systems, which are mostly incompatible with new REU technologies. It would require a great deal of investment and expertise to integrate new REUs into their existing infrastructure. This acts as a barrier to businesses that require modernization in their systems.
In conclusion, the German market for REUs is driven fundamentally by technological developments, sustainability efforts, and government initiatives. However, there are challenges concerning cybersecurity, regulatory compliance, and integration with legacy systems, which will influence the future development and adoption of REUs throughout the German industries.
